When was I-465 built in Indiana?

I-74 was the first interstate to cross Indiana. The first section opened in 1960 and the final section opened in 1967. Construction of I-465, which circles Marion County in central Indiana, started in 1959. The first section opened in 1961; the final section was completed in 1970.

When was 465 built?

Construction of the loop began in 1959 and the first segment opened to traffic in 1961. The entire I-465 loop was completed by 1970. I-465 did not directly replace all of SR 100, as a portion of the route remains along Shadeland Avenue.

Is there a bypass around Indianapolis?

Interstate 465 (I-465), also known as the USS Indianapolis Memorial Highway, is the beltway circling Indianapolis, Indiana, United States. It is roughly rectangular in shape and has a perimeter of approximately 53 miles (85 km).
